Brie Schmidt
Breaking News: Eviction Ban Is Unlawful
5 May 2021 | 0 replies
Friedrich's ruling applies nationwide.The eviction ban was put in place last year by the Trump administration using public health powers granted to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ention during health emergencies.The ban was most recently extended by President Biden through the end of June.In her 20-page ruling, Friedrich said, “It is the role of the political branches, and not the courts, to assess the merits of policy measures designed to combat the spread of disease, even during a global pandemic.
